WebAn undertaking is no more than a promise (made to the court) by the perpetrator to refrain from further domestic and family violence. The perpetrator may have previously broken similar promises made to the victim and others . WebA criminal history can prevent you from working with children, in a hospital, in a bank, at a casino or as a security guard. Potential employers are also more likely to employ a person without any convictions over someone who has even a minor criminal conviction. A criminal conviction can also make it difficult to obtain visas for overseas travel.
